
Mustangs Fall Short in Showdown at Olsen Stadium
SIOUX CITY, IOWA – Tasillo Koerner provided a spark, but the Mustangs were unable to get anything else going as they fell to Grand View, 2-1, today. The opportunistic Vikings took the lead with just over a minute off the clock, keeping Morningside in the rear view mirror the entire contest.
Koerner's goal, one of two shots on goal, came on an assist from Gustavo Dos Santos. Bennet Wesselkaemper matched Koerner's two shots on goal with a pair of his own.
Timon Koerber took the loss in goal for the Mustangs, splitting time in the contest with Tim Tescher, who had three saves in the second half.
